adjective
- Measured by an angle or by the rate of change of an angle.
- usage: "angular momentum"
- Having angles or an angular shape.
- synonyms: angulate

Usually refers to recommendation that leads an investor to reduce their investment in a particular security or asset class. The reduction is usually with respect to a benchmark. Suppose that U. S. Equities compose 40% of the benchmark portfolio. If one thinks the U. S. Will underperform, the investor may reduce the exposure to U. S. Equity to less than 40%.
